    Caracterização das habilidades funcionais na síndrome de Rett

    O objetivo deste estudo foi identificar as áreas de maior comprometimento nas habilidades funcionais na síndrome de Rett (SR). Foram avaliadas 64 pacientes que preenchiam os critérios para a forma clássica da doença, com idade entre 2 e 26 anos. Foi aplicado o Inventário de avaliação pediátrica de incapacidade (PEDI) que contém 197 itens nas áreas de autocuidado, mobilidade e função social. Dentre as 73 atividades da área de autocuidado, 52 (71,2%) não foram realizadas por qualquer paciente; na mobilidade, dentre as 59 atividades propostas, 8 (13,5%); e na área de função social, dentre as 65 atividades, 50 (76,9%) não foram realizadas por paciente alguma. O desempenho médio ajustado em escala de 0 a 100 para a área de autocuidado foi de 8,9/100, variando de 0 a 19; na área de mobilidade, foi de 30,2/100, variando de 1 a 44; e na de função social, 5,2/100, com variação de 0 a 14. Foi possível verificar fortes correlações entre a área de autocuidado e as de mobilidade e função social; no entanto, entre as áreas de mobilidade e função social não foi detectada correlação significativa. Infelizmente, devido à gravidade da síndrome, o menor comprometimento da mobilidade, comparado ao das áreas de autocuidado e função social, não traz vantagens adaptativas ou maior independência às pacientes com SR.The purpose of this study was to determine the areas of greater impairment in functional abilities of patients with Rett syndrome. Sixty-four patients aged 2 to 26 years old, who filled out criteria for the classic form of the disease, were assessed by the Pediatric Evaluation of Disability Inventory (PEDI) of which 197 items are grouped in the areas of self-care, mobility, and social function. From the 73 activities in self-care area, 52 (71.2%) were not accomplished by any patient; in mobility area, among the 59 proposed activities, 8 (13.5%); and in social function area, from 65 activities, 50 (76.9%) could not be accomplished. Adjusted mean results in a 0-to-100 scale were: self-care, 8.9/100, varying from 0 to 19; mobility, 30.2/100, varying from 1 to 44; and social function, 5.2/100, varying from 0 to 14. Strong correlations were found between self-care area and mobility and social function areas, but no significant correlation between the latter. Unfortunately, due to the serious impairment of the disease, the fact that mobility is affected to a lesser degree, as compared to self-care and social function, does not bring Rett syndrome patients any adaptive advantage nor greater independence

    Avaliação motora e funcional de pacientes com paraplegia espástica, atrofia óptica e neuropatia (SPOAN)

    Spastic paraplegia, optic atrophy, and neuropathy (SPOAN) is an autosomal recessive complicated form of hereditary spastic paraplegia, which is clinically defined by congenital optic atrophy, infancy-onset progressive spastic paraplegia and peripheral neuropathy. In this study, which included 61 individuals (age 5-72 years, 42 females) affected by SPOAN, a comprehensive motor and functional evaluation was performed, using modified Barthel index, modified Ashworth scale, hand grip strength measured with a hydraulic dynamometer and two hereditary spastic paraplegia scales. Modified Barthel index, which evaluate several functional aspects, was more sensitive to disclose disease progression than the spastic paraplegia scales. Spasticity showed a bimodal distribution, with both grades 1 (minimum) and 4 (maximum). Hand grip strength showed a moderate inverse correlation with age. Combination of early onset spastic paraplegia and progressive polyneuropathy make SPOAN disability overwhelming.A paraplegia espástica, atrofia óptica e neuropatia (SPOAN) é uma forma complicada de paraplegia espástica de herança autossômica recessiva, caracterizada por atrofia óptica congênita, paraplegia espástica progressiva de início na infância e neuropatia periférica. Este estudo avaliou o desempenho motor e funcional de 61 indivíduos com SPOAN (5 a 72 anos), por meio do índice de Barthel modificado, a escala modificada de Ashworth, da avaliação da força de preensão das mãos com dinamômetro hidráulico de Jamar e escalas de paraplegia espástica hereditária. O índice de Barthel modificado, que investiga aspectos funcionais, mostrou-se mais sensível para avaliar a progressão da doença do que as escalas de paraplegia espástica. A espasticidade apresentou distribuição bimodal, com o grau 1 (mínimo) e 4 (máximo). A força de preensão mostrou correlação inversa moderada com a idade. A combinação de paraplegia espástica de início precoce com polineuropatia progressiva faz da SPOAN uma condição incapacitante

    Spastic Paraplegia, Optic Atrophy, and Neuropathy: New Observations, Locus Refinement, and Exclusion of Candidate Genes

    Summary SPOAN is an autosomal recessive neurodegenerative disorder which was recently characterized by our group in a large inbred Brazilian family with 25 affected individuals. This condition is clinically defined by: 1. congenital optic atrophy; 2. progressive spastic paraplegia with onset in infancy; and 3. progressive motor and sensory axonal neuropathy. Overall, we are now aware of 68 SPOAN patients (45 females and 23 males, with age ranging from 5 to 72 years), 44 of which are presented here for the first time. They were all born in the same geographic micro region. Those 68 patients belong to 43 sibships, 40 of which exhibit parental consanguinity. Sixty-one patients were fully clinically evaluated and 64 were included in the genetic investigation. All molecularly studied patients are homozygotes for D11S1889 at 11q13. This enabled us to reduce the critical region for the SPOAN gene from 4.8 to 2.3 Mb, with a maximum two point lod score of 33.2 (with marker D11S987) and of 27.0 (with marker D11S1889). Three genes located in this newly defined critical region were sequenced, but no pathogenic mutation was detected. The gene responsible for SPOAN remains elusive

    Quantification of functional abilities in Rett syndrome: a comparison between stages III and IV

    We aimed to evaluate the functional abilities of persons with Rett syndrome (RTT) in stages III and IV. The group consisted of 60 females who had been diagnosed with RTT: 38 in stage III, mean age (years) of 9.14, with a standard deviation of 5.84 (minimum 2.2/maximum 26.4); and 22 in stage IV, mean age of 12.45, with a standard deviation of 6.17 (minimum 5.3/maximum 26.9). The evaluation was made using the Pediatric Evaluation of Disability Inventory, which has 197 items in the areas of self-care, mobility, and social function. The results showed that in the area of self-care, stage III and stage IV RTT persons had a level of 24.12 and 18.36 (P=0.002), respectively. In the area of mobility, stage III had 37.22 and stage IV had 14.64 (P<0.001), while in the area of social function, stage III had 17.72 and stage IV had 12.14 (P=0.016).     A Previously Undescribed Syndrome Combining Fibular Agenesis/Hypoplasia, Oligodactylous Clubfeet, Anonychia/Ungual Hypoplasia, and Other Defects

    We describe an apparently new genetic syndrome in six members of a family living in a remote area in Northeastern Brazil. This syndrome comprises: short stature Clue to a marked decrease in the length of the lower limbs (predominantly mesomelic with fibular agenesis/marked hypoplasia), grossly malformed/deformed clubfeet with severe oligodactyly, tipper limbs with acromial dimples and variable motion limitation of the forearms and/or hands, severe nail hypoplasia/anonychia sometimes associated with mild brachydactyly and occasionally with pre-axial polydactyly. This syndrome is apparently distinct from the syndrome of brachydactyly-ectrodactyly with fibular aplasia or hypoplasia (OMIM 113310), the syndrome of fibular aplasia or hypoplasia, femoral bowing and poly-, syn-, and oligodactyly (OMIM 228930), and from other previously described conditions exhibiting fibular agenesis/hvpoplasia.
